mine was actually up and out of the hole it sits in, and was off to the side of the batt. I changed battery this weekend, and seen where it was supposed to go.
My 3 conductor positive batt cable was sporting one of those cheesy sheetmetal clamps from previous owner, so I modified it with a nice larger cable.... solely to the power distribution box. I recrimped an eye on the starter cable, and put it and one more hot wire under that lug. So far, so good. (I wasn't in the mood to fish the old wire out, and put a new one in clear to the starter that day). Cost? $15.
I will do the negative side next. Same deal there, I will go to the waterpump lug with one nice conductor, and put the body, chassis grounds under that lug.
